Ignore/Ovewrite.pigbootup 配置
Ignore/Ovewrite .pigbootup configurations
我配置了一个 .pigbootup
文件,它为所有 pig 作业配置了 SET DEFAULT_PARALLEL
。我正在处理的脚本不需要那么多 reducer,我不想使用该配置。我怎样才能overwrite/ignore这个文件中给出的配置?
我发现这是完全忽略 .pigbootup
文件的好方法。但是,如果您想覆盖 属性 值并仍然使用现有配置,那么我认为这不是一个好主意。但是,我的情况很好。
pig -Dpig.load.default.statements=/tmp/.non-existent-pigboot -f test.pig
参考 - https://hadoopified.wordpress.com/2013/02/06/pig-specify-a-default-script/
我配置了一个 .pigbootup
文件,它为所有 pig 作业配置了 SET DEFAULT_PARALLEL
。我正在处理的脚本不需要那么多 reducer,我不想使用该配置。我怎样才能overwrite/ignore这个文件中给出的配置?
我发现这是完全忽略 .pigbootup
文件的好方法。但是,如果您想覆盖 属性 值并仍然使用现有配置,那么我认为这不是一个好主意。但是,我的情况很好。
pig -Dpig.load.default.statements=/tmp/.non-existent-pigboot -f test.pig
参考 - https://hadoopified.wordpress.com/2013/02/06/pig-specify-a-default-script/